i’m getting back into writing right now! writing fiction used to be a big interest of mine, but i lost confidence in my abilities and eventually developed anxiety around writing basically anything at all. i’ve mostly worked through that though :) my goal is to have a piece of writing of any length that i can say is complete.

my favourite method is writing by hand, specifically in cursive. i’m probably going to switch to using my phone with a bluetooth keyboard, though - i have fragments of a bunch of different things and can’t organize them easily on paper.

also, sometimes i draw, paint, or do linocut printing. making prints is a lot of fun! i’ve made band patches as well as original pieces. for mediums i like both linoleum and softer plastic blocks, but not the really soft ones as they tend to flake. but maybe it’s that my cheap speedball carving tool isn’t sharp enough lol

I do a lot of digital art. I draw sometimes, but my motorskills leave a lot to be desired (I draw with my wrist, not my arm, and I have shaky hands); so if I’m doing anything more than sketching, I need to draw in Procreate so I can keep retrying each line until it looks how I want.

Because of this, I usually stick to vector art, which is much cleaner regardless of motor skills. I lucked out and bought Illustrator when it was CS6 and not Creative Cloud, so I’m still using that and will likely continue to use it forever (I hate consumer SaaS with a passion).
